Environmental

Electro-Magnetic-Compatibility (EMC)
EN 61326 (2005-12) for emission and immunity
Storage Temperature
-20°C ~ +60°C
Maximum Operating Altitude
Up to 2,000 m (6666 ft) for CAT IV 600 V, CAT III 1000 V Up to 3,000 m (10,000 ft) for CAT III 600 V, CAT II 1000 V Maximum storage altitude 12 km (40,000 ft)
Humidity
+10°C ~ +30°C: 95% RH non-condensing +30°C ~ +40°C: 75% RH non-condensing +40°C ~ +50°C: 45% RH non-condensing
Interfaces
Mini-USB-B, Isolated USB port for PC connectivity SD card slot accessible behind instrument battery
Operating Temperature
0°C ~ +40°C; +40°C ~ +50°C excl. battery

Warranty
Three years (parts and labor) on main instrument, one year on accessories

General Specifications

Memory
8 GB SD card (SDHC compliant, FAT32 formatted) standard, upto 32 GB optionally Screen save and multiple data memories for storing data including recordings (dependent on memory size)
Display
Brightness: 200 cd/m 2 typ. using power adapter, 90 cd/m 2 typical using battery power Size: 127 x 88 mm (153 mm/6.0 in diagonal) LCD Resolution: 320 x 240 pixels Contrast and brightness: user-adjustable, temperature compensated
Case
Design Rugged, shock proof with integrated protective holster Drip and dust proof IP51 according to IEC60529 when used in tilt stand position Shock and vibration Shock 30 g, vibration: 3 g sinusoid, random 0.03 g 2 /Hz according to MIL-PRF-28800F Class 2
Real-Time Clock
Time and date stamp for Trend mode, Transient display, System Monitor and event capture
